Honeymoon in Morocco

3 Most popular honeymoon destinations in Morocco

  1. Marrakech: Marrakech, known as the "Red City", is one of Morocco's top honeymoon destinations. Its winding medina alleys, vibrant souks, and iconic Djemaa el-Fna square will fascinate newlyweds who love history and culture. Honeymooners can stay in a traditional riad, explore the city's imperial architecture—including the Bahia Palace and El Badi Palace— and wander the lush French-artist botanical gardens. Day trips to the Atlas Mountains and the Sahara Desert add couple-friendly activities (like camel riding!) to your itinerary for a complete honeymoon trip in Marrakech.

  2. Casablanca: Casablanca, Morocco's largest city, offers a modern take on a Moroccan honeymoon. The coastal metropolis features Art Deco architecture and trendy restaurants alongside Old Medina charm for the leisurely indulgence of couples. Honeymooners can visit the Hassan II Mosque, browse the Habous handicraft market, and enjoy Casablanca's lively nightlife as a part of a couples' private Morocco trip itinerary.

  3. Agadir: With its beautiful beaches and relaxed seaside ambiance, Agadir is an idyllic honeymoon destination for newlyweds seeking tranquility. Stroll hand-in-hand along the boardwalk, lounge at chic beach clubs, or charter a private boat to explore Agadir's picturesque coastline. Inland, the Valley of the Birds and Paradise Valley offer serene natural retreats away from the beach. Agadir's laidback vibes, sweeping ocean vistas, and sunny climate all year round provide the perfect soothing setting by the sea for couples to relax and celebrate their love.

Travel tips for Honeymoon tours in Morocco

  • The best time to visit Morocco for your honeymoon is in the spring and autumn months for pleasantly warm weather, perfect for strolling through the medinas and soaking up the sun with your loved one.
  • Public displays of affection between opposite sexes, such as kissing, are not widely accepted in Morocco, so please be mindful of this to steer clear of awkward glances and unwanted attention.
  • When in Morocco, remember to dress modestly and cover your legs and arms as a sign of respect for local customs and traditions.
  • To pull off a budget trip in Morocco as newlyweds, utilize the well-connected train system around the country that is rather light to your pockets.
